Floristic Analysis of Vascular Plants of Baerluke Mountain in Xinjiang

Abstract: There is rich biodiversity and special geographical position in Baerluke Mountain in Xinjiang. In this paper,we analyzed the flora composition and geographical composition of Baerluke Mountain in detail,and briefly described the endemic and rare and endangered species in this flora. Results indicate: there are three biggest families in Baerluke Mountain,which are Asteraceae,Poaceae and Fabaceae,including 424 species,accounted for percent 32.6 of the total of the species in the mountain. In the distribution area type of families,the Cosmopolitan distribution area type is the biggest one,including 42 families,accounted for percent 28.9. In the distribution area type of genera,the North Temperate distribution area type is the dominant one,including 178 genera,accounted for percent 38.6. In the distribution area type of species,the temperate elements are dominant; among them the Old World Temperate distribution area type is the most widespread one,including 297 species. The second large component of this flora is Tethyan species,most of them are the mutual species for both Kazakhstan flora and Zhungaer flora,and this means study area is the confluence of Iran-Turan flora and Zhungaer flora. In addition,being the bridge between Siberian (Altai) and Tianshan flora from north to south,study area was the border for some species of these two big floras. There are over 50 species listed into the rare and endangered species in study area,and 6 species endemic to Baerluke Mountain. The study could provide basic data for the protection of wildlife in this area,environmental protection and nature reserve,the promotion national protected areas. It is of great practical significance to protect nature reserve,the original ecology,the rare and endangered flora composition in Baerluke Mountain.
